New Zealand U15 Athletes Selected for ITTF Rising Stars Training Camp

Yelena Yi

Four of New Zealand’s Under 15 athletes are currently gaining valuable international experience at the International Table Tennis Federation (ITTF) Rising Stars Training Camp in Mississauga, Canada from 9 to 14 May 2026.

Lucas Alexandre, Angel Han, Yelena Yi and Eli Ho are participating in the ITTF Rising Stars Training Camp, which forms part of the ITTF High Performance Training Activities Calendar. The initiative brings together talented young athletes from around the world for intensive training and international development opportunities.

 

Following the camp, the athletes will continue their international tour by competing at two World Table Tennis (WTT) Youth Contender events:
• WTT Youth Contender Mississauga 2026 (15 to 18 May)
• WTT Youth Contender San Francisco II 2026 (22 to 25 May)

The athletes are supported by coaches Hyojoo Lee and Josh Alexandre during the tour.

TTNZ would like to thank the ITTF for providing international development opportunities for New Zealand athletes through both the ITTF Rising Stars Training Camp and the “With The Future In Mind” Scholarship programme. These initiatives continue to support promising young athletes through high level training, international competition exposure and athlete development opportunities.

New Zealand athletes Eli Ho, Lucas Alexandre and Angel Han were announced in April 2026 as recipients of the “With The Future In Mind” Scholarship. The initiative continues to play an important role in developing the next generation of athletes and growing the sport globally.
